In this episode of the Corporate Musclecast, Dave & Trent discuss the "people first" approach of two very different, and very successful, companies - payments firm Gravity Payments, and online shoe retailer Zappos.
Founded by two brothers in 2004, Gravity Payments shocked the world in 2015 by introducing a minimum salary of USD$70k for all employees, and reducing the CEO's own salary from $1.1m down to $70k. We look into the people outcomes that helped lock in engagement and more than triple the business to see payment volumes exceed $10Bn per annum in 2018.
Online shoe and accessories retailer Zappos, under the leadership of Tony Hsieh, took an equally employee-centric approach, from it's founding days in 1999 through to eventual $1.2Bn sale to Amazon in 2009.
